CVE-2022-4979: Sitecore XP 7.5 - 10.2, CMS 7.2, and Managed Cloud XSS
A c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ability exists in Sitecore Experience Platform (XP) 7.5 - 10.2 and CMS 7.2 - 7.2 Update-6 that may allow authenticated Sitecore Shell users to be tricked into executing custom JS code. Managed Cloud Standard customers who run the affected Sitecore Experience Platform / CMS versions are also affected.

How do I fix CVE-2022-4979?
To fix CVE-2022-4979, upgrade Sitecore Experience Platform to version 10.3 or later and Sitecore CMS to version 7.2 Update-7 or later.
